My Project

The additional seating will give my students options of where to sit that they feel is the ideal place to learn. Choice is compelling and teaches students to learn and collaborate in different classroom settings. Furthermore, it prepares them for the future, as they are our future. During independent and group work, my students can always sit where they feel best. I have found that giving students options empowers them and motivates them to work on their goals. Imagine not having to sit at a desk all day.

My aim is to create a welcoming and calm classroom environment that will help all of my students succeed socially and academically and keep them engaged, giving them the option to sit where they are most comfortable.

The products I have selected will help my students by giving them more classroom options. Being where one is most comfortable keeps each attentive and focused, creating control and autonomy over one's learning. Students are at school for so many hours a day. It is like their home away from home. I aim to bring my students closer to our classroom community to provide social-emotional support and a comfortable space to learn, work, and flourish.

The primary benefits of flexible seating are increased collaboration, reduced extended sitting at a student desk and helping students focus. These chairs will bring an engaging and comfortable space for students who need more motion as they learn and help each individual become a better-thinking and productive member of their classroom community.
